Cultivating Emotional Intelligence in Adolescents: A Holistic Approach

Emotional intelligence (EI), encompassing self-awareness, self-regulation, social awareness, and relationship management, is increasingly recognized as a crucial determinant of adolescent well-being and success. This article explores a comprehensive framework for fostering EI in teenagers, drawing upon established psychological theories and models such as Goleman's model of EI and Bandura's social cognitive theory. We will examine practical strategies for cultivating each component of EI, considering their application within educational and familial contexts.

1. Cultivating Self-Awareness: The Foundation of Emotional Intelligence

Self-awareness, the cornerstone of EI, involves recognizing and understanding one's own emotions, thoughts, and behaviors. This foundational aspect can be developed through introspection exercises, journaling prompts focusing on emotional experiences, and reflective discussions. Applying the principles of mindfulness, adolescents can learn to observe their internal states without judgment, enhancing their capacity for self-understanding. This aligns with the core tenets of mindfulness-based stress reduction techniques, proven to improve self-awareness and emotional regulation in various age groups.

2. Mastering Emotional Regulation: Managing Internal States

Emotional regulation, the ability to manage one's emotional responses effectively, is critical for navigating the challenges of adolescence. Techniques like deep breathing exercises, progressive muscle relaxation, and cognitive reframing can be taught to adolescents as tools for managing overwhelming emotions. These strategies are rooted in c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) principles, demonstrating efficacy in reducing anxiety and improving emotional control. The application of these techniques can empower adolescents to respond to stressful situations constructively, fostering resilience.

3. Fostering Social Awareness: Understanding Others' Perspectives

Social awareness involves understanding and empathizing with the emotions and perspectives of others. Role-playing exercises, discussions centered on diverse perspectives, and exposure to diverse literature and media can enhance adolescentsโ€™ capacity for empathy. Perspective-taking, a key component of social cognition as described by social cognitive theory, facilitates understanding diverse viewpoints, promoting tolerance and compassion. The application of this principle encourages prosocial behavior and strengthens interpersonal relationships.

4. Developing Relationship Management: Building Positive Connections

Relationship management encompasses the ability to build and maintain healthy relationships. Effective communication skills training, focusing on assertive and respectful communication, active listening, and conflict resolution, are vital. These techniques align with principles of interpersonal effectiveness training, enhancing adolescentsโ€™ abilities to navigate interpersonal conflicts and build supportive relationships. Group projects and collaborative activities provide practical opportunities to apply these skills, strengthening teamwork and cooperation.

5. Goal Setting and Resilience: Navigating Challenges and Setbacks

Establishing clear goals and developing resilience are integral to emotional well-being. Goal-setting frameworks, such as SMART goals (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ound), can be introduced to help adolescents plan and achieve their objectives. This process cultivates self-efficacy, a concept central to Bandura's social cognitive theory, enabling them to overcome obstacles and bounce back from setbacks. By understanding that challenges are opportunities for growth, adolescents develop psychological hardiness and improve their coping mechanisms.

6. Promoting Inclusivity and Addressing Bullying: Creating a Supportive Environment

Promoting inclusivity and addressing bullying are crucial for creating a supportive environment where all adolescents can thrive. Education on diversity and cultural sensitivity, coupled with proactive anti-bullying initiatives, is essential. The application of social learning theory highlights the importance of modeling positive behavior and reinforcing inclusive attitudes, thereby reducing the prevalence of bullying and fostering a sense of belonging.

7. Utilizing Diverse Learning Strategies: Literature and Mentorship

Literature and mentorship offer unique avenues for developing EI. Engaging with literature exploring diverse emotions and experiences fosters empathy and self-reflection. Similarly, mentorship programs, connecting adolescents with positive role models, provide guidance and support in navigating emotional challenges and developing healthy coping strategies. This approach leverages the principles of social learning, where observational learning and modeling play a significant role in shaping adolescents' behavior and attitudes.

Conclusions and Recommendations

Cultivating emotional intelligence in adolescents is not merely a desirable outcome; it's a crucial investment in their future well-being and success. A holistic approach, integrating self-awareness, emotional regulation, social awareness, and relationship management, is essential. By applying evidence-based strategies within educational and family settings and leveraging various learning methodologies, we can empower adolescents to navigate life's complexities with greater resilience, empathy, and success. Further research should explore the long-term impact of comprehensive EI interventions on academic achievement, mental health, and social adaptation. The development and implementation of standardized assessment tools for measuring EI in adolescents would also significantly advance this field. The applicability of these strategies extends beyond formal educational settings, impacting various aspects of adolescent development and community engagement.
